HB16 by Lozano (Relating to sexual assault, family violence, and stalking at public and private postsecondary educational institutions.), As Introduced

No significant fiscal implication to the State is anticipated.

The bill would require public and private postsecondary educational institutions to adopt a policy on campus sexual assault, family violence and stalking. The bill would require the institutions to develop and establish an online reporting system. The bill would also require each peace officer employed by the institution to complete training on trauma-informed investigation into allegations of sexual assault and enter into a memorandum of understanding with law enforcement agencies, sexual assault advocacy groups and other entities to facilitate effective communication and coordination regarding allegations of sexual assault at the institutions. Under provisions of the bill, the Higher Education Coordinating Board would be required to adopt rules as necessary to implement and enforce provisions of the bill including rules that ensure confidentiality of student educational information. Based on the analysis provided by institutions of higher education, duties and responsibilities associated with implementing the provisions of the bill could be accomplished by utilizing existing resources. It is assumed that the Higher Education Coordinating Board could implement provisions of the bill within existing resources.

Local Government Impact

No significant fiscal implication to units of local government is anticipated.
